What does Luke 24:9 mean?

The women who had discovered Jesus' empty tomb were so moved by what they'd witnessed that they immediately went to find his disciples and shared the news. They didn't keep this extraordinary experience to themselves, but spread word to the eleven apostles and everyone else who was gathered with them, likely in Jerusalem where Jesus' followers had gone after his crucifixion. This verse captures that first urgent impulse to tell others about resurrection, the foundation of Christian faith. It reminds us that encountering something life-changing naturally moves us to share it with those we care about.
